Abstract

The utility model belongs to the technical field of submerged reef warning devices, in particular to an offshore submerged reef warning device, which comprises a base, wherein a supporting column is arranged at the top end of the base, an adjusting component is arranged at the top end of the supporting column, a solar cell panel is arranged at the top end of the adjusting component, a winding component is arranged on one side of the supporting column and below the adjusting component, the solar cell panel is connected with the winding component through electric wires, a plurality of floating seats are arranged on one side of the base, a transparent plate is arranged at the middle position of the top end of each floating seat, a plurality of warning lamps are respectively and uniformly arranged on two sides of the transparent plate, two adjacent warning lamps are connected through a marine cable, and the marine cable is connected with the solar cell panel through the electric wires; the solar energy can be converted to the maximum extent, the wide elastic rope can be replaced conveniently, and the floating seat is restored to the original position.

Background
Reefs potentially harmful to navigation; reef at the top of which is below the lower limit of the tidal water submergence line in the zone according to the marine chart rules; metaphorically potential obstacles. Often hidden in the rock below the water surface. Is an obstacle to navigation. For safety, its position needs to be accurately plotted on the nautical chart; if the navigation mark is positioned on a near route, the navigation mark is arranged on the water surface.
The conventional submerged reef warning device is matched with a solar panel, a warning lamp, a floating seat and other devices, and when the submerged reef warning device is used, because an angle carrying device capable of carrying out angle carrying on the solar panel is arranged on one side of the bottom end of the solar panel, the maximum conversion of solar energy can not be carried out in the specific use process; simultaneously, only place the electric wire through the runner, keep away from the reef at floating the seat after, the length of electric wire can furthest extend and can not contract the cable, removes to reef one side at floating the seat after, can make the cable that extends soak in the sea water, and then the life-span of greatly reduced cable.
In order to solve the problem, the application provides an offshore submerged reef warning device.
